Doctors often choose this when a natural birth becomes too risky for the mother or baby. Timing is everything. If labor stops progressing, the baby\u2019s heart rate drops, or there are signs of distress, doctors need to act fast.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Delays can happen for many reasons. Sometimes, hospital staff miss the warning signs. Other times, they wait too long, hoping things get better on their own. In some cases, there aren\u2019t enough staff or operating rooms available. No matter the reason, a delay can mean less oxygen for the baby. Lack of oxygen, even for just a few minutes, can cause brain damage, cerebral palsy, or other lifelong injuries.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">When staff don\u2019t follow proper procedures, it can lead to tragedy. They will review your case, explain your rights, and help you decide what to do next.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>How long do I have to file a birth injury lawsuit in Philadelphia?<\/strong><br>In Pennsylvania, the statute of limitations for most medical malpractice and birth injury cases is two years from when you knew or should have known about the injury. However, if your child was injured, they may have until age 20 to file a claim. It\u2019s important to act quickly\u2014waiting too long could mean losing your right to compensation.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>Can a birth injury lawsuit really make a difference for my family?<\/strong><br>Yes.
